What The Product Actually Is

The description states:

  • Show Me the Menu is a search tool that locates restaurant menus directly from the restaurant’s own website.
  • It uses OpenAI’s API for web search, Cheerio for HTML parsing, pdf-parse for PDF extraction, and fallbacks to Toast Tab and Square menu links.
  • It was built with React, Vite, Node.js, Express, and deployed as a Vercel Function.
  • The tool is responsive and includes mobile/desktop support.

Inference: Based on the author's description, it appears to be a web-based menu-search utility that aggregates menu data from multiple sources using serverless infrastructure and AI-assisted search. It is not a marketplace or platform for restaurants to publish menus — rather, it’s a consumer-facing tool that helps users find existing menus.

Technical & Delivery Signals

The description states:

  • Built with React and Vite frontend.
  • Backed by Node.js and Express menu-search service deployed as a Vercel Function.
  • Uses OpenAI API, Cheerio, pdf-parse, and Open-Meteo.
  • Includes fallbacks to Toast Tab and Square menus.
  • Responsive interface for mobile and desktop.

Inference: The tool is built with modern web technologies and serverless deployment. It uses AI for search and parsing techniques to extract menu data from various formats (HTML, PDF). It includes fallback logic for different menu delivery methods.

Competitive Context

The description states:

  • There is no standard way restaurants publish their menus.
  • Some use embedded iframes, others link to POS systems, some upload PDFs.
  • The author’s solution attempts to handle this inconsistency.

Inference: The competitive landscape includes various restaurant websites and third-party platforms (e.g., Toast, Square) that host menus. However, no direct competitors are named or described in the write-up.
